Chapter 4 MATERIAL BALANCES AND APPLICATIONS - KFUPM

Material balances are nothing more than the application of the law of conservation of mass, which states that mass can neither be created nor destroyed. Thus, you cannot, for example, specify an input to a reactor of one ton of naphtha and an output of two tons of gasoline or gases or anything else.

Practical integrated metallurgical accounting ... - ABB

mass conservation equations). Data reconciliation via this means (mass balancing) improves accuracy of process and assay data. This resulting reconciliation benefits the entire plant operation by providing access to those variables/values that cannot be directly measured. Mass balance calculations use flow measurements and assay data to improve ...

A specific energy-based size reduction model for batch ...

A particle size reduction model has been developed as the first component of an upgraded ball mill model. The model is based on a specific energy-size reduction function, which calculates the particle breakage index, t 10, according to the size-specific energy, and then calculates the full product size distribution using the t 10-t n relationships and the mass-size balance approach.

MASS BALANCES - University of Washington

Mass balance equations are formal statements of the law of conservation of mass, and it is no exaggeration to think of them as the "F = ma" of environmental engineering. They represent the starting point, either explicitly or implicitly, for almost any environmental analysis, allowing us to keep track of any material as it moves through and ...

Mass balance in closed circuit grinding - Grinding ...

How to establish a mass balance and derive the circulation load of a closed circuit given the specific gravities of the mill discharge to classifier, underflow and overflow from the classifier? An iron ore company milled ore at the rate of 150 t/h in a ball mill in closed circuit with a classifier.

Ball Mill mass balance in steady state - Grinding ...

2. follow the same procedure to the ball mill, since it is a close circuit with the sump. mass to the ball mill is same as the discharged mass. mind that, we are not talking about water balance yet. 3.amount of water in to the sump ( in the feed + added water + water from circulating load) = amount of water leaving
